Frederikshb vs Voronez Climate & Distance Between

Russia flag
  • The distance between Frederikshb, Greenland and Voronez, Russia is approximately 5,085 km or 3,160 mi.
  • To reach Frederikshb in this distance one would set out from Voronez bearing 319.1°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Frederikshb bearing 240° or WSW .
  • Frederikshb has a tundra climate (ET) whereas Voronez has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b).
  • Frederikshb is in or near the subpolar rain tundra biome whereas Voronez is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
  • The average annual temperature is 6.9 °C (12.4°F) cooler.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 16.3 °C (29.3°F) less in Frederikshb.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to truly continental.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 296.7 mm (11.7 in) more which is equivalent to 296.7 l/m² (7.28 US gal/ft²) or 2,967,000 l/ha (317,192 US gal/ac) more. About 1 1/2 as much.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 10.4° lower in Frederikshb than in Voronez.
